The first chimney I ever had (not a Weber) got left out in the weather a lot and only lasted a couple of years.  My current one (a Weber)  has been kept inside since I got it and is still going strong after 5 years.  I also have a no name chimney that I got with a used kettle is still in very good condition.  Sometimes I use both to get 2 kettles up and running.
Take care of your chimney and it'll last a long time.

My first one is 10 years old. It's been left in the elements the entire time. About 8 years in, it started rusting through in spots but still usable. 9 years in and it busted the top rivet. I bolted it and still use it. I bought a new one a couple years ago but still use both.  Best $14.99 you can spend.

I'm in Indiana so the weather hasn't been good to it.
